attar definition

at·tar (atər)

noun

an essential oil or perfume made from the petals of flowers, esp. of damask roses (attar of roses)

Etymology: Pers ʼatar, fragrance < Ar ʿuṭūr, ʿoṭār, pl. of ʿiṭr, perfume
